kapitalrörelseöppenhet
Kapitalrörelseöppenhet, often translated as capital account openness, refers to the extent to which capital can flow freely into and out of a country. This includes the ability of individuals and institutions to invest in foreign assets, borrow from foreign lenders, and repatriate profits. A high degree of capital account openness implies minimal restrictions on such cross-border financial transactions.
The concept is distinct from trade liberalization, which focuses on the free movement of goods and services.
